A delegate from Quakers Services Norway visits Gaza Community Mental Health Programme

A delegate from Quakers Services Norway (QSN) represented by Mrs. Christine Hofland, Projects’ Manager at QSN visited GCMHP and met with a number of GCMHP staff including Dr. Yasser Abu Jamei, Director General of GCMHP, Mr. Qusi Abu Ouda, Head of Projects Unit and Mrs. Samar Al Malfoh, a Project Coordinator. The meeting was held at the Programme’s headquarter in Gaza city.

Dr. Abu Jamei welcomed the delegate, appreciating QSN  partnership with GCMHP since 2007 and their effective contribution in achieving the Programme’s strategic objectives; especially their support for “Save Spaces to Learn and Play Refugee Children”. He highlighted that this project is the only one in the Strip which provides services for children in the kindergarten and their caregivers. He added that the project takes into consideration both gender. It also promotes the children’s participation in activities’ designing, implementation, monitoring and evaluation.

Moreover, Mr. Abu Ouda discussed a presentation about the impact of this project on the beneficiaries.

Furthermore, Mrs. Al Malfoh presented the achievements of the project during 2017, in addition to the project’s interventions in 2018.

During the meeting, the participants discussed the most important challenges and problems that appeared during the implementation of the project in 2017.

At the end of the meeting, Dr. Abu Jamei thanked the delegation for their visit and their effective partnership with GCMHP; hoping to strengthen this relationship in order to improve the psychological condition for the children in the Gaza Strip.
